Gerald “Jerry” Wayne Royer, 67, of Indianapolis, formerly of Jasper, passed away at 9:25 a.m., Tuesday, February 6, 2018, at Cypress Grove Rehabilitation Center, Newburgh, Indiana

He was born September 26, 1950, in Huntingburg, Indiana to Homer Lee and Martha Jane (Selby) Royer, Jr.  Jerry was a licensed funeral director; a former Dubois County Coroner; had previously worked for the Ferdinand Police Department and the Marion County Police Department; a former Lieutenant of Marion County Sheriff Department.  He had served in the Army at Worms, Germany in communications; was a Viet Nam veteran and a former member of the Jasper VFW.  Jerry was a 32nd degree mason of the Nobels of the Mystic Shrine.   He loved his canine friends especially Effie.  He was preceded in death by his parents.

He is survived by his sister, Carolyn Sue (Bernard) Kemker of Jasper; a brother, Thomas Allen (Sue) Royer, nieces, a nephew and friends.

Funeral services for Gerald “Jerry” Wayne Royer will be held at 11:00 a.m., E.S.T, Friday, February 9, 2018, at St. Joseph’s Catholic Church with burial to follow at Enlow Cemetery in Jasper with military graveside rites conducted by the Jasper VFW Post # 673 Memorial Detail.

Friends may call for visitation at the Nass & Son Funeral Home in Huntingburg from 4:00-8:00 p.m., E.S.T., on Thursday, February 8th.   A masonic service will be held at 7:00 p.m. by the Dubois County Masonic Lodge #520 F&AM.  The Marion County Sheriff’s Department will conduct a memorial service Friday morning at the funeral home prior to the church service.
